Steele Cares Boys Home

We went to Steele Cares Boys Home yesterday and took 6 loaded back packs and other books/school supplies. They are a boys home in Dallas with such a heart for kids. They are developing a boys home that will have 6 boys ages 12 and up. They are in the process of creating a computer lab for the boys. They are in need of clothing, any type of food, toiletries, and most importantly funding.

Warehouse of Hope

Please check out the website for the Warehouse of Hope in Paulding County. I went to the Warehouse of Hope today and worked in the Warehouse. They are always looking for volunteers. They have a 12 for 12 program where you can donate $12.00 a month for 12 months. The Warehouse of Hope currently supports over 500 families with clothing and food each week. www.warehouseofhope.org
